Transaction 7043e103a329aa54abbc4565ed60ca7c9502c63423139f812cbe1c709f218c3a

block
329823de2c7ee1edafddd94486c9eb0398f99053171160fd81e5f05dd5b193b3

2 Inputs

2 Outputs